How AI Answer Engines Decide Which Financial Advisors to Cite

Google’s AI Overviews and tools like Perplexity don’t randomly pick a financial advisor to recommend. They pull from pages that demonstrate three things: topical authority (you’ve covered the subject thoroughly), structured data (your site is marked up in a way machines can parse), and local signals (your NAP data, Google Business Profile, and geo-tagged content confirm you serve this specific area).

Topical Authority for Central Illinois Financial Topics

A Springfield financial advisor who publishes useful, specific content — think “how Illinois state pension changes affect private savers in Sangamon County” or “estate planning considerations for Springfield-area state employees” — builds a subject-matter footprint that AI engines can reference confidently. Generic content about retirement planning that could apply to anyone, anywhere, rarely earns a citation.

Structured Data and Schema Markup

Schema markup is the behind-the-scenes code that tells search engines exactly what your page contains — a financial service, a local business, an FAQ. Without it, even a well-written page leaves AI engines guessing. Properly implemented structured data, as described by Google Search Central, significantly improves the likelihood your content is pulled into AI-generated responses.

Local Signals That Confirm Your Springfield Presence

Your Google Business Profile category, your service-area pages, citations on Illinois-based directories, and even consistent use of Sangamon County and Springfield-specific language in your content all reinforce that you’re a real, active local provider — not a national brand with a virtual address on South Sixth Street.

AEO vs. Traditional SEO: What Springfield Advisors Should Understand

Traditional SEO and AEO are complementary, not competing strategies. SEO gets you ranking on page one; AEO gets you into the answer itself — the zero-click response that appears before any organic results. For financial advisors, where trust is the primary conversion driver, being the answer an AI cites carries enormous credibility weight.

That said, AEO doesn’t replace the fundamentals. A Springfield advisor who hasn’t done the groundwork on local SEO — accurate citations, a well-optimized site, a healthy backlink profile from Illinois sources — will find AEO gains harder to sustain. What structured data should a Springfield financial advisor use?

At minimum: LocalBusiness schema (with FinancialService type), FAQPage schema on answer-rich pages, and BreadcrumbList schema for site navigation. If you publish articles, Article schema helps. These markup types tell AI engines precisely what your firm does, where it operates, and what questions your content answers.
